How Ring Cameras Operate
Ring cameras operate primarily over Wi-Fi networks, connecting to a central app or cloud service to stream video and send alerts. They use motion sensors, infrared for night vision, and high-definition cameras to capture footage. The Wi-Fi connection allows users to access live feeds remotely, receive notifications, and communicate through two-way audio features. Because these cameras rely on wireless signals, their operation can be affected by signal interference, weak networks, or intentional jamming attempts. Understanding the communication protocols and wireless dependencies is key to assessing vulnerabilities.
Types of Jamming and Interference
Jamming generally refers to the intentional interference with wireless signals to disrupt communication. For Ring cameras, this could include
- Wi-Fi jammingDevices that transmit signals on the same frequency can overwhelm the camera’s Wi-Fi connection, preventing it from sending video feeds.
- Radio frequency interferenceStrong radio signals in close proximity can interfere with the device’s transmission.
- Physical network disruptionCutting off the internet connection or turning off routers can effectively disable the camera.
While these methods may temporarily disable a Ring camera, they are generally illegal in many countries due to the potential danger they pose to public communications and emergency services.
How Likely Are Ring Cameras to Be Jammed?
Although jamming is technically possible, it is not a common occurrence. Most criminals do not possess the knowledge or equipment required to effectively jam security cameras without detection. Additionally, Ring devices are designed to alert users immediately when they go offline, providing early warning of potential tampering. Users can often see when the device stops recording, enabling them to respond quickly. Moreover, the presence of multiple cameras and a robust security setup makes it difficult to disable all surveillance simultaneously.
Security Features Against Interference
Ring has implemented several features to reduce vulnerability to jamming and interference
- Instant alertsUsers receive notifications if a camera loses connection or stops transmitting, making suspicious activity immediately noticeable.
- Cloud recordingVideo is stored in the cloud, so even if a camera is tampered with, past footage remains accessible.
- Encrypted data transmissionThe Wi-Fi signal and video data are encrypted, preventing easy interception or manipulation.
These measures significantly reduce the effectiveness of casual tampering attempts and make Ring cameras more resilient than traditional surveillance systems.
Practical Measures to Prevent Jamming
Homeowners and businesses can take additional steps to protect their Ring cameras from potential jamming attempts. These measures include
- Securing Wi-Fi networksUse strong passwords, WPA3 encryption, and regularly update firmware to reduce vulnerability to interference.
- Using multiple camerasInstalling several cameras covering overlapping areas ensures that disabling one does not compromise overall security.
- Monitoring network healthSetting up alerts for unusual network activity can detect interference early.
- Physical securityPlacing cameras in high, inaccessible locations makes it difficult for anyone to approach and tamper with them.
By combining these precautions with the built-in features of Ring cameras, users can create a security system that is resistant to both intentional and accidental interference.
Legal and Ethical Considerations
It is important to note that jamming any wireless communication device, including Ring cameras, is illegal in many countries. The Federal Communications Commission (FCC) in the United States explicitly prohibits the use of jammers, and penalties can include fines and criminal charges. Attempting to jam a camera not only puts the perpetrator at legal risk but also endangers other wireless communications in the vicinity, including emergency calls and critical services. From an ethical perspective, tampering with someone else’s security system is a serious violation of privacy and property rights.
Real-World Implications
While the theoretical possibility of jamming exists, practical real-world attacks are rare. Most security breaches involve weak passwords, unpatched software, or physical theft of devices rather than sophisticated signal jamming. Ring cameras are designed to work even under challenging network conditions, and their cloud-based infrastructure ensures that footage remains accessible even if a local device is temporarily offline. For most users, the combination of encrypted communication, instant alerts, and reliable cloud storage provides sufficient protection against common threats.
